01 What is a bituminous membrane?
It is a waterproofing material made from bitumen, commonly used for roofing and underground applications. It forms a durable, flexible, and seamless layer that protects structures from water, UV rays, and harsh weather conditions.
02 How long does a bituminous membrane last?
A properly installed it can last up to 30 years or more with minimal maintenance, depending on environmental factors and proper care.
03 What are the benefits of using bituminous membranes?
It offer excellent waterproofing, UV resistance, flexibility, chemical resistance, and impact durability, making them ideal for a wide range of applications, including roofs, foundations, and parking decks.
04 Can bituminous membranes be applied to existing surfaces?
Yes, It can be applied to both new and existing surfaces. They are particularly effective for waterproofing renovations, retrofitting older buildings, and strengthening existing roofing systems.
05 How is a bituminous membrane installed?
It can be applied using torch-on, cold-applied, or self-adhesive methods, depending on the project’s requirements and conditions. The application creates a seamless, waterproof barrier that protects against water infiltration.
